Job Description

As the Deputy Head of Group FP&A you will play a pivotal role in shaping the financial strategy and insights that drive the business forward. Your responsibilities will include leading the coordination and consolidation of Group FP&A reporting ensuring the delivery of actionable insights for the Executive team Board and senior management.

Collaboration is key as youll foster strong relationships with senior management and crossfunctional teams aligning efforts to achieve strategic goals. You will also support investor relations by analyzing financial data for external market announcements ensuring transparency and accuracy.

Your role extends to facilitating scenario planning including assessing the financial impact of M&A activities. Acting as a trusted deputy for the Head of Group FP&A you will contribute to the growth and development of the FP&A team mentoring and coaching to cultivate talent and ensure ongoing success.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ee the review and challenge of budgets forecasts and longterm strategic plans.
  • Lead the coordination and consolidation of Group FP&A reporting delivering actionable insights for the Executive team Board and senior management.
  • Monitor business performance KPIs risks and opportunities providing commercially focused insights to inform decisionmaking.
  • Drive continuous improvement in financial analysis systems and reporting processes.
  • Foster effective collaboration with senior management and crossfunctional teams.
  • Support investor relations by analyzing financial information for external market announcements.
  • Facilitate scenario planning including the financial impact of M&A activities.
  • Act as a deputy for the Head of Group FP&A contributing to team development through coaching and mentoring.

Qualifications :

Skills & Abilities

  • Extensive seniorlevel experience within FP&A at a large or listed organization.
  • Strong influencing and presentation skills with the ability to engage senior stakeholders effectively.
  • Thrives in fastpaced environments delivering highquality outputs under tight deadlines.
  • Proven leadership skills with a successful track record of managing and developing teams.
  • Recognized professional accounting qualification (e.g. ACA ACCA or CIMA)
